Cambio de visibilidad al elemento winForms alojado en la aplicación wpf
-
20-08-2019 - |
Pregunta
Tengo el control ReportViewer winForms para mostrar informes de Microsoft en mi aplicación WPF alojada en WindowsFormsIntegration. Cuando se activa el evento MouseDown de mi textBlock, me gustaría que se desvanezca, digamos de 0 a 100 de visibilidad, como algunos otros elementos en mi ventana. No lo hace, así que me preguntaba si es lo mismo para todos los controles alojados o este específico y ¿cómo se puede resolver?
Saludos,
Ivan
Solución
El WindowsFormsHost admite Transparencia. Pero algunos controles WinForms no lo hacen.
Consulte Escenarios admitidos en Windows Presentation Foundation y Windows Forms Interoperation artículo sobre MSDN. Especialmente la primera fila en & Quot; Comportamiento & Quot; tabla:
Algunos controles de Windows Forms no Apoyar la transparencia. Por ejemplo, el Los controles TextBox y ComboBox no ser transparente cuando sea alojado por WPF.